+#include "ASessionDescription.h"
+
+#include <media/stagefright/foundation/ADebug.h>
+#include <media/stagefright/foundation/AString.h>
+
+#include <stdlib.h>
+
+namespace android {
+
+ASessionDescription::ASessionDescription()
+ : mIsValid(false) {
+}
+
+ASessionDescription::~ASessionDescription() {
+}
+
+bool ASessionDescription::setTo(const void *data, size_t size) {
+ mIsValid = parse(data, size);
+
+ if (!mIsValid) {
+ mTracks.clear();
+ mFormats.clear();
+ }
+
+ return mIsValid;
+}
+
+bool ASessionDescription::parse(const void *data, size_t size) {
+ mTracks.clear();
+ mFormats.clear();
+
+ mTracks.push(Attribs());
+ mFormats.push(AString("[root]"));
+
+ AString desc((const char *)data, size);
+ LOG(VERBOSE) << desc;
+
+ size_t i = 0;
+ for (;;) {
+ ssize_t eolPos = desc.find("\r\n", i);
+ if (eolPos < 0) {
+ break;
+ }
+
+ AString line(desc, i, eolPos - i);
+
+ if (line.size() < 2 || line.c_str()[1] != '=') {
+ return false;
+ }
+
+ switch (line.c_str()[0]) {
+ case 'v':
+ {
+ if (strcmp(line.c_str(), "v=0")) {
+ return false;
+ }
+ break;
+ }
+
+ case 'a':
+ case 'b':
+ {
+ AString key, value;
+
+ ssize_t colonPos = line.find(":", 2);
+ if (colonPos < 0) {
+ key = line;
+ } else {
+ key.setTo(line, 0, colonPos);
+
+ if (key == "a=fmtp" || key == "a=rtpmap"
+ || key == "a=framesize") {
+ ssize_t spacePos = line.find(" ", colonPos + 1);
+ if (spacePos < 0) {
+ return false;
+ }
+
+ key.setTo(line, 0, spacePos);
+
+ colonPos = spacePos;
+ }
+
+ value.setTo(line, colonPos + 1, line.size() - colonPos - 1);
+ }
+
+ key.trim();
+ value.trim();
+
+ LOG(VERBOSE) << "adding '" << key << "' => '" << value << "'";
+
+ mTracks.editItemAt(mTracks.size() - 1).add(key, value);
+ break;
+ }
+
+ case 'm':
+ {
+ LOG(VERBOSE) << "new section '" << AString(line, 2, line.size() - 2) << "'";
+
+ mTracks.push(Attribs());
+ mFormats.push(AString(line, 2, line.size() - 2));
+ break;
+ }
+ }
+
+ i = eolPos + 2;
+ }
+
+ return true;
+}
+
+bool ASessionDescription::isValid() const {
+ return mIsValid;
+}
+
+size_t ASessionDescription::countTracks() const {
+ return mTracks.size();
+}
+
+void ASessionDescription::getFormat(size_t index, AString *value) const {
+ CHECK_GE(index, 0u);
+ CHECK_LT(index, mTracks.size());
+
+ *value = mFormats.itemAt(index);
+}
+
+bool ASessionDescription::findAttribute(
+ size_t index, const char *key, AString *value) const {
+ CHECK_GE(index, 0u);
+ CHECK_LT(index, mTracks.size());
+
+ value->clear();
+
+ const Attribs &track = mTracks.itemAt(index);
+ ssize_t i = track.indexOfKey(AString(key));
+
+ if (i < 0) {
+ return false;
+ }
+
+ *value = track.valueAt(i);
+
+ return true;
+}
+
+void ASessionDescription::getFormatType(
+ size_t index, unsigned long *PT,
+ AString *desc, AString *params) const {
+ AString format;
+ getFormat(index, &format);
+
+ char *lastSpacePos = strrchr(format.c_str(), ' ');
+ CHECK(lastSpacePos != NULL);
+
+ char *end;
+ unsigned long x = strtoul(lastSpacePos + 1, &end, 10);
+ CHECK_GT(end, lastSpacePos + 1);
+ CHECK_EQ(*end, '\0');
+
+ *PT = x;
+
+ char key[20];
+ sprintf(key, "a=rtpmap:%lu", x);
+
+ CHECK(findAttribute(index, key, desc));
+
+ sprintf(key, "a=fmtp:%lu", x);
+ if (!findAttribute(index, key, params)) {
+ params->clear();
+ }
+}
+
+void ASessionDescription::getDimensions(
+ size_t index, unsigned long PT,
+ int32_t *width, int32_t *height) const {
+ char key[20];
+ sprintf(key, "a=framesize:%lu", PT);
+ AString value;
+ CHECK(findAttribute(index, key, &value));
+
+ const char *s = value.c_str();
+ char *end;
+ *width = strtoul(s, &end, 10);
+ CHECK_GT(end, s);
+ CHECK_EQ(*end, '-');
+
+ s = end + 1;
+ *height = strtoul(s, &end, 10);
+ CHECK_GT(end, s);
+ CHECK_EQ(*end, '\0');
+}
+
+bool ASessionDescription::getDurationUs(int64_t *durationUs) const {
+ *durationUs = 0;
+
+ CHECK(mIsValid);
+
+ AString value;
+ if (!findAttribute(0, "a=range", &value)) {
+ return false;
+ }
+
+ if (value == "npt=now-") {
+ return false;
+ }
+
+ if (strncmp(value.c_str(), "npt=", 4)) {
+ return false;
+ }
+
+ const char *s = value.c_str() + 4;
+ char *end;
+ double from = strtod(s, &end);
+ CHECK_GT(end, s);
+ CHECK_EQ(*end, '-');
+
+ s = end + 1;
+ double to = strtod(s, &end);
+ CHECK_GT(end, s);
+ CHECK_EQ(*end, '\0');
+
+ CHECK_GE(to, from);
+
+ *durationUs = (int64_t)((to - from) * 1E6);
+
+ return true;
+}
+
+// static
+void ASessionDescription::ParseFormatDesc(
+ const char *desc, int32_t *timescale, int32_t *numChannels) {
+ const char *slash1 = strchr(desc, '/');
+ CHECK(slash1 != NULL);
+
+ const char *s = slash1 + 1;
+ char *end;
+ unsigned long x = strtoul(s, &end, 10);
+ CHECK_GT(end, s);
+ CHECK(*end == '\0' || *end == '/');
+
+ *timescale = x;
+ *numChannels = 1;
+
+ if (*end == '/') {
+ s = end + 1;
+ unsigned long x = strtoul(s, &end, 10);
+ CHECK_GT(end, s);
+ CHECK_EQ(*end, '\0');
+
+ *numChannels = x;
+ }
+}
+
+} // namespace android
